Description

1,1,1,3,3,3-Hexafluoro-2-Iodopropane is a specialized fluorinated organic iodide compound, valued for its unique combination of high volatility and the reactivity of the iodine atom. This chemical serves as a critical building block and reagent in advanced synthetic chemistry, enabling the introduction of fluorinated segments into target molecules. It is primarily sought by research and development laboratories and chemical manufacturers in the pharmaceutical, agrochemical, and materials science sectors for creating novel compounds with tailored properties.

Application

  • Pharmaceutical Intermediate: Used in the synthesis of fluorinated active pharmaceutical ingredients (APIs) and diagnostic agents.
  • Agrochemical Synthesis: Serves as a key reagent for developing novel fluorinated pesticides and herbicides with enhanced efficacy.
  • Advanced Material Precursor: Employed in the production of specialty polymers, liquid crystals, and organic electronic materials.
  • Organic Synthesis Reagent: Acts as a versatile reagent for nucleophilic substitution and coupling reactions to introduce perfluoroisopropyl or iodine functional groups.
  • Chemical Research & Development: A valuable tool for medicinal chemistry and material science research exploring structure-activity relationships.
  • Fluorinated Surfactant/Additive Synthesis: Used in the creation of surface-active agents and performance additives.

Basic Information

Item Details
Product Name 1,1,1,3,3,3-Hexafluoro-2-Iodopropane
CAS No. 4141-91-7
Molecular Formula C3HF6I
Molecular Weight 295.93 g/mol
Synonyms Hexafluoro-2-iodopropane; 2-Iodo-1,1,1,3,3,3-hexafluoropropane; Perfluoroisopropyl iodide; 1,1,1,3,3,3-Hexafluoroisopropyl iodide; (Perfluoroisopropyl)iodide; PFPI; HFIP-I; CF3CHICF3
EINECS 223-975-8

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, well-ventilated area away from heat sources and incompatible materials. Due to its highly volatile nature, ensure containers are kept upright and sealed when not in use. Recommended storage temperature is 2-8°C for extended stability.

Specification

Item Specification
Appearance Clear, colorless to pale yellow liquid
Identification (IR) Conforms to structure
Assay (GC) ≥ 98.0%
Water Content (KF) ≤ 0.1%
Density (at 20°C) ~2.1 g/mL
Boiling Point ~ 40-42°C
